Experiments to identify precision grip dynamics between the index finger and thumb have been performed using a ball-drop experiment. A subject holds a device with a small receptacle into which an object is dropped, and the response is measured (Fagergren, 2000). Assuming a step input, it has been found that the response of the motor subsystem together with the sensory system is of the form

Y(s) s+c G(s) = R(s) (s2 + as + b)(s + d)

Convert this transfer function to a state-space representation.
